英文摘要Co-n-c catalysts are promising candidates for substituting platinum in electrocatalysis and organic transformations. the heterogeneity of the co species resulting from high-temperature pyrolysis, however, encumbers the structural identification of active sites. herein, we report a self-supporting co-n-c catalyst wherein cobalt is dispersed exclusively as single atoms. by using sub-angstrom-resolution haadf-stem in combination with xafs and dft calculation, the exact structure of the co-n-c is identified to be con4c8-1-2o(2), where the co center atom is coordinated with four pyridinic n atoms in the graphitic layer, while two oxygen molecules are weakly adsorbed on co atoms in perpendicular to the co-n-4 plane. this single-atom dispersed co-n-c catalyst presents excellent performance for the chemoselective hydrogenation of nitroarenes to produce azo compounds under mild reaction conditions.
